I drive Camrys but think it's Electronic Control Transmission. Basically just changes the shift points up slightly for a more sporty feel. I would recommend you keep it off as theoretically it reduces MPG. If you have an O/D button you will probably want to keep it in. (Not like it's a race car anyway.) :D
